揭开HTML/CSS编程世界的神秘面纱:HTML语言的丰富功能
2024-01-22 03:26:49
HTML:构建网页的基石
欢迎来到互联网世界的乐园,在那里我们遨游在信息和连接的汪洋中。为了构建这些引人入胜的数字世界,我们离不开一种神奇的语言——HTML。
HTML:超文本标记语言
想象一下网页就像一座座建筑,HTML就是建造这些建筑的蓝图。它是一种标记语言,这意味着它使用一系列标签来定义网页的结构和内容。就像砖块和木板构成建筑物一样,HTML标签构成网页的基础。
HTML标签:网页的构造块
HTML标签就像乐高积木,可以自由组合来创建各种复杂的结构。每个标签由一个标签名和尖括号组成,例如<p>
表示段落,<ul>
表示无序列表。标签可以嵌套在一起,形成分层结构,就像摩天大楼的层层叠加。
HTML属性:为标签注入个性
属性为HTML标签添加了额外的信息和功能。就像给乐高积木添加颜色和纹理一样,属性可以改变标签的外观和行为。例如,id
属性为每个标签分配一个唯一标识符,style
属性控制标签的字体、颜色和布局。
HTML元素:标签与内容的结合
HTML元素是由标签和标签之间的内容组成的。它们就像乐高积木中的组件,可以组合在一起形成复杂的结构。段落、列表和标题都是常见的HTML元素,构成网页的骨架。
HTML文档结构:网页的布局
一个完整的HTML文档就像一张蓝图,它规定了网页各个部分的排列方式。它通常分为三个主要部分:
- HTML头: 包含有关网页的信息,如标题和元数据。
- HTML正文: 包含网页的主要内容,如文本、图像和视频。
- HTML脚: 包含版权信息和联系方式等信息。
HTML5:HTML的演进
随着互联网的不断发展,HTML也随之进化。HTML5是HTML的最新版本,它带来了激动人心的新特性,让构建网页变得更加轻松和强大。
代码示例:HTML标签和元素
<!DOCTYPE html>
<html>
<head>
</head>
<body>
<h1>欢迎来到我的网页!</h1>
<p>这是一个段落。它包含一些文本。</p>
<ul>
<li>列表项 1</li>
<li>列表项 2</li>
<li>列表项 3</li>
</ul>
</body>
</html>
HTML与CSS:风格与结构的分离
HTML负责网页的结构,而CSS(层叠样式表)负责网页的外观。CSS允许您控制字体、颜色、布局和其他视觉元素,将结构和风格分离开来。
HTML与JavaScript:为网页注入交互性
JavaScript是一种脚本语言,可为网页添加交互性和动态性。它可以控制元素、响应事件并创建动画效果,让网页充满生机。
结论:HTML,网页构建的基础
HTML是构建网页的基石,它定义了网页的结构、内容和基本布局。有了HTML,您可以创建各种令人惊叹的数字体验,从简单的个人博客到交互式电子商务商店。随着HTML5的出现,构建网页变得比以往任何时候都更加轻松和强大。
常见问题解答
-
HTML和网站有什么关系?
HTML是创建网站的基础语言。它提供网页的结构和内容,而CSS和JavaScript则负责风格和交互性。 -
我可以使用HTML做什么?
您可以使用HTML构建各种网页,包括个人博客、电子商务商店、社交媒体页面和其他在线内容。 -
学习HTML难吗?
HTML相对容易学习。它是一种直观的语言,即使是初学者也可以很快掌握其基本原理。 -
HTML5有什么新特性?
HTML5引入了许多新特性,例如新的标签、属性和API,使构建网页变得更加轻松和高效。 -
HTML和Web开发有什么区别?
HTML是Web开发的基础,但它只是众多Web开发技术中的一种。Web开发还包括CSS、JavaScript、服务器端技术和数据库。